AMG TimesSquare International Small Cap Fund (TCMIX) Research
Under normal circumstances, the fund primarily invests in equity securities of smaller companies, allocating at least 80% of its net assets, plus any borrowed funds for investment purposes, to this segment. Additionally, a minimum of 40% of its net assets (along with any borrowed money for investment) will be directed towards issuers located outside the United States or to investments that provide exposure to such international entities. This global investment strategy will involve exposure to at least three different countries, excluding the United States.
